China announced this week a comprehensive plan to phase out single use plastics.

The plan will start with banning all non-degradable bags in major cities by the end of this year and in the rest of the country by 2022. 

Other items such as plastic utensils, food packaging, straws, bottles, and more will also be phased out. 

China has long struggled with handling the waste of it’s 1.3 billion and counting population. The country’s largest dump, about the size of 100 football fields, is already full, 25 years ahead of schedule. 

This move represents a major win for the environment as China produces over 20% of the world’s plastic waste.
